Heavy trucks are a constant presence on the highways all across the country. These vehicles carry freight of all sorts, often traveling from one end of the nation to the other in order to deliver their hauls to their destinations. Many truck drivers are conscious of safety and will take the necessary steps to ensure that they and their freight arrive safe and sound. However, some truckers feel the pressure of time, and may cut corners or disregard safety rules in order to make better time. These practices can be dangerous, both for themselves and those they share the roads with, resulting in tragic accidents that could have been prevented. Every year, the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ration provides a report regarding semi truck accident-related injuries and deaths. In 2016, more than 4,000 heavy trucks were involved in accidents that resulted in death, and more than 50,000 trucks were involves in crashes that resulted in injuries. The majority of these crashes involved multiple vehicles. The large size and heavy weight of semi trucks makes multi-vehicle involvement all too common when collisions occur.
